Description

Suricata before 4.0.4 is prone to an HTTP detection bypass vulnerability in detect.c and stream-tcp.c. If a malicious server breaks a normal TCP flow and sends data before the 3-way handshake is complete, then the data sent by the malicious server will be accepted by web clients such as a web browser or Linux CLI utilities, but ignored by Suricata IDS signatures. This mostly affects IDS signatures for the HTTP protocol and TCP stream content; signatures for TCP packets will inspect such network traffic as usual.

Common questions

How do I fix CVE-2018-6794?

Upgrade suricata on debian 11 to 1:4.0.4-1 or later.

Is CVE-2018-6794 being actively exploited?

Not that we know of. CVE-2018-6794 is not in the CISA Known Exploited Vulnerabilities catalog. Its EPSS score of 24.3% is the estimated probability that it will be exploited in the next 30 days. That is higher than 98% of all scored CVEs.

How severe is CVE-2018-6794?

CVE-2018-6794 has a CVSS v3 base score of 5.3, rated medium. CVSS rates the technical impact if the vulnerability is exploited, not how likely that is, so weigh it alongside the exploit-prediction score when you decide what to patch first.
